Ferris State University Power Outage

UPDATE: Tuesday, Jan. 14, 2014 at 3 p.m.

Power has been restored to all areas of Ferris State University’s Big Rapids campus.


UPDATE: Tuesday, Jan. 14, 2014 at 12:45 p.m.

The installment of a replacement transformer to restore power to the northeast area of the Ferris State University Big Rapids campus is in progress. To best ensure that the replacement transformer is safely installed, powered up and tested, the start of classes held in the Alumni and Prakken buildings will be pushed back to 3 p.m. All classes in the affected buildings beginning prior to 3 p.m. are canceled. Classes beginning at 3 p.m., or later, are expected to be held as normally scheduled in Alumni and Prakken.

Power has been restored in the Automotive Building, and classes are on as scheduled beginning at 1 p.m.

Day-shift employees working in Alumni, Prakken and West buildings will be delayed beginning work until 2 p.m. to allow complete installation, power up and testing of the replacement transformer. Any employees with questions about whether they should report should contact their supervisors.

UPDATE: Monday, Jan. 13, 2014 at 11:30 p.m.

As of 11:30 p.m., this evening (Jan. 13), power to the northeast area of the Ferris State University's Big Rapids campus remains out due to a failed transformer. A potential replacement transformer did not fix the issue. The University is currently exploring another option to bring the northeast region of campus back online by noon on Tuesday, Jan. 14.

As a result of the northeast campus power outage, morning classes in Alumni, Automotive and Prakken buildings are canceled. Classes will resume as scheduled beginning at 1 p.m. on Tuesday, Jan. 14. Day-shift employees working in Alumni, Automotive, Prakken and West buildings should not report to work until 1 p.m. unless otherwise directed by their supervisors. Any employees with questions about whether they should report are encouraged to contact their supervisors.

Power on west campus remains restored.

UPDATE: Monday, Jan. 13, 2014 at 6:30 p.m.

As of 6:30 p.m. today (Jan.13), a blown fuse has been replaced and power has been restored to the southwest area of the Big Rapids campus.

The power outage affecting northeast campus was caused by a transformer failure. A replacement transformer is en route to Big Rapids and power restoration is expected by midnight.

UPDATE: Monday, Jan. 13, 2014 at 5 p.m.

As of 4:30 p.m. today (Jan. 13), Ferris State University continues to experience a power outage that affects various academic buildings, residence halls and student apartments on the Big Rapids campus.

An issue with a transformer is believed to have caused the power outage in Prakken, Alumni, West, Automotive and Granger buildings.

A second unrelated power outage has affected facilities south of Ferris Drive, including Henderson, Puterbaugh, Bond, Cramer and Bishop halls, Westside Cafe, West Campus Apartments, Creative Arts Center and Southwest Commons.

There may be intermittent power outages as crews work to restore power.
